Folate (Vitamin B9) is one of these raw materials and the MTHFR enzyme is the body’s … Web25 mar. 2024 · The most common variant in the MTHFR gene is called C677T. About 20 to 40% of white and Hispanic individuals in the U.S. have one copy of C677T, which reduces enzyme function by approximately 35%, while 8 to 20% of the population has two copies of C677T (one from each parent), which reduces enzyme function by up to 70%. spartanburg regional hospital employees https://soulfitfoods.com

Web7 iul. 2015 · People with a mutation in 1 MTHFR gene are are said to be heterozygous; if mutations are present in both genes, the person is said to be homozygous or compound … Web15 dec. 2024 · The MTHFR gene codes for an enzyme known as methylenetetrahydrofolate reductase or MTHFR. This enzyme is responsible for converting 5, 10-methylene THF to 5-methyl THF, which is essential for the conversion of the amino acid homocysteine to methionine [1, 2].. WebBackground A polymorphism is a variant within a gene that does not necessarily affect its function, unlike a pathogenic mutation. Genetic testing for two common polymorphisms in the methylenetetrahydrofolate reductase gene (MTHFR), 677C>T and 1298A>C, is being accessed by general practitioners (GPs) and alternative medicine practitioners (based on … WebMTHFR Blood Test. You, of course, can always ask your primary care physician to order an MTHFR blood test for you. Although, most insurance companies do not cover this type of MTHFR gene test, and may leave you with an $800-$1,000 bill. Homocysteine Test. A less expensive MTHFR gene test typically covered by insurance is a homocysteine test.

Web5 feb. 2024 · Having a functional MTHFR gene means that the body can convert homocysteine to methionine while having a mutated MTHFR gene indicates susceptibility to hyperhomocysteinemia. Hyperhomocysteinemia is a condition that is characterized by the buildup of homocysteine in the plasma [ citation ].
